Definition Of Lower Belly Pooch

Lower belly pooch refers to excess fat located in the lower abdomen, just below the belly button. It is a common area of concern for many people, regardless of gender. While lower belly pooch may not pose any health risks, it can cause insecurity and self-consciousness, particularly when wearing form-fitting clothing such as jeans.

Causes Of Lower Belly Pooch

Several factors can contribute to the development of lower belly pooch, including:

  • Sedentary lifestyle: A lack of physical activity can lead to a decrease in muscle tone and an increase in body fat, including in the lower belly area.
  • Genetics: Some people may be predisposed to store excess fat in their lower abdominal region.
  • Hormonal changes: Fluctuations in hormones, particularly in women during menstruation, menopause, or pregnancy, can cause an increase in belly fat.
  • Poor diet: Consuming a diet high in processed foods, sugar, and unhealthy fats can lead to weight gain and an increase in belly fat.

Choosing The Right Jeans

Picking Jeans That Complement Your Body Type:

When it comes to hiding lower belly pooch in jeans, picking the right style is crucial. Not all jeans are created equal, and different fits will flatter different body types. Here are some tips on how to choose the right jeans for your body type:

  • Pear-shaped: Go for a bootcut or flared style to balance out wider hips. Avoid high-rise skinny jeans, as they will only accentuate your lower belly pooch.
  • Hourglass-shaped: Lucky you! Almost any style will work, but high-waisted skinny jeans can really flatter your curves.
  • Apple-shaped: Look for jeans with a contoured waistband that will fit well at the waistline and lay smoothly against your stomach. Avoid low-rise jeans, as they will sit below the belly and create a muffin top.
  • Athletic shaped: If you have a straighter figure, try skinny jeans with a mid-rise or high-rise waistband. This will help create curves and accentuate your waistline. Wide-leg jeans can also be a good choice, as they will add volume to your lower half.

Understanding The Importance Of High-Waisted Jeans:

One of the best ways to hide lower belly pooch is by wearing high-waisted jeans. Here’s why:

  • High-waisted jeans sit above your belly button, pulling everything in and creating a smooth silhouette.
  • They can help eliminate the appearance of muffin tops, love handles, and other common trouble areas.
  • High-waisted jeans can also make your legs appear longer, as the waistline hits at the smallest part of your torso.

Avoiding Skinny Jeans:

While skinny jeans may be on-trend, they’re not always the best choice when it comes to hiding lower belly pooch. Here’s why:

  • Skinny jeans are often low-rise, meaning they sit below the belly and can create a muffin top.
  • They’re also tight-fitting, which can accentuate any bumps or lumps.
  • Skinny jeans can restrict movement and be uncomfortable for extended periods of wear.

Instead, opt for jeans with a wider leg, such as straight leg or bootcut styles. Not only will they be more comfortable, but they’ll also help create a more balanced silhouette and make your midsection appear slimmer.

Styling Your Outfit

Ways To Create A Flattering Look

When it comes to hiding that lower belly pooch in jeans, it’s all about creating a flattering look. Lucky for you, there are a variety of ways to do just that. Here are a few tips to help you perfect your style game:

  • Opt for high-waisted jeans to smooth out any bumps and lumps in the lower belly area.
  • Choose jeans with a darker wash, as they tend to be more slimming and create a clean line down the leg.
  • Avoid wearing jeans with distressed detailing or embellishments around the lower belly area, as they can draw unwanted attention to that area.
  • Look for jeans with a thicker waistband or a cinched-in waist to help create an hourglass figure.

Accessorizing To Hide Lower Belly Pooch

If you’re looking for an extra boost of confidence and style when it comes to concealing that lower belly pooch, accessorizing can be your best friend. Here are a few accessory tips to keep in mind:

  • Try wearing a wide belt over your jeans to cinch in your waist and create the illusion of an hourglass figure.
  • Opt for a longer top or sweater that hits mid-thigh to create a slimming effect on your lower belly area.
  • Accessorize with statement earrings or a necklace to draw attention upwards and away from the lower belly area.
  • Wear shoes with a slight heel to create a longer, leaner silhouette.

Tips For Layering

Layering is a great way to add both style and functionality to your outfit, especially when it comes to hiding that lower belly pooch in jeans. Here are a few tips for layering your outfit in a way that flatters your figure:

  • Start with a fitted base layer, like a tank top or slim-fitting long-sleeved shirt.
  • Add a light cardigan or button-up shirt as your second layer to add dimension to your outfit.
  • Finish off your look with a blazer or jacket that hits at your waist or slightly below to create a definitive waistline and draw attention away from the lower belly area.
  • Choose layers with a lightweight fabric to avoid adding bulk to your frame.

Incorporating Exercise And Nutrition

Importance Of A Healthy Diet To Reduce Pooch Pouch

Diet plays a crucial role in reducing belly pooch. Your body stores fat when you consume more calories than it can burn. Hence, a healthy, balanced diet is essential to target belly fat. Here are a few key points to keep in mind:

  • Incorporate more proteins in your diet as it can aid in weight loss. It also helps reduce cravings and keeps you full for a longer duration.
  • Avoid processed foods and refined sugar as they can cause inflammation and bloating. It can also cause weight gain and hinder progress.
  • Add more fiber in your diet. Food rich in fiber keeps you full and aids in digestion. It also reduces inflammation and helps in weight loss.
  • Incorporate healthy fats such as avocados, nuts, and seeds in your diet. These fats promote weight loss and keep you healthy.

Best Exercises For Slimming Down Lower Belly Pooch

Regular exercise is an effective way to reduce belly fat. It not only helps you shed weight but also improves your overall health. Here are a few exercises to incorporate in your workout routine:

  • Planks: This exercise helps build core strength and targets the lower belly pooch. It also improves flexibility and balance.
  • Bicycle crunches: It is an effective workout that targets the lower abdominal muscles. It involves a coordinated movement that helps you burn calories fast.
  • Leg raises: Leg raises help tone your lower abdominal muscles and strengthen your core. This exercise also helps improve stability and balance.
  • Cardio exercises: Cardio workouts such as running, cycling, or aerobics help in overall weight loss. It promotes calorie burn and aids in reducing belly fat.

How Can I Hide My Lower Belly Pooch In Jeans?

To hide lower belly pooch in jeans, try high rise jeans that sit at or above belly button. Choose jeans with stretchy denim, avoid low rise and tight fitting jeans. Opt for dark colored jeans and avoid embellishments or detailing around the waistline.

Can Shapewear Help Hide Lower Belly Pooch In Jeans?

Yes, wearing shapewear can help hide lower belly pooch in jeans. Look for shapewear that targets the lower belly area and make sure it fits well without creating any bulges. Avoid wearing shapewear that is too tight or uncomfortable.
